9.8 小红书笔试
1.机器人走地图,看是否会越界,越界就-1,输出最终剩的机器人,简单的dfs即可
2.数组区间和最小,贪心思路,让越小的数字用的最多,可以先统计出每个位置的数各会用多少次,然后升序排列,和原数组进行对应相乘即可,java注意开long类型
3.位运算,我的思路是用32个hashmap记录相同1个数的数字,然后遍历数字,去map中查看有没有符合的,累加,维护最大值,但没全过...,有佬有更好的思路吗?
2.数组区间和最小,贪心思路,让越小的数字用的最多,可以先统计出每个位置的数各会用多少次,然后升序排列,和原数组进行对应相乘即可,java注意开long类型
3.位运算,我的思路是用32个hashmap记录相同1个数的数字,然后遍历数字,去map中查看有没有符合的,累加,维护最大值,但没全过...,有佬有更好的思路吗?
全部评论
大佬可以贴下第一题代码吗,我也相同思路没全过
第三题可以用力扣的下一个排列思路
第三题能把函数g写出来就好说
佬,第二题怎么统计每个位置的使用次数 啊
相关推荐
查看17道真题和解析
点赞 评论 收藏
分享
11-18 23:54
门头沟学院 大数据开发工程师 点赞 评论 收藏
分享